John Hollis Bankhead, Rep. from Alabama, with Son, William B. Bankhead, 1917. Bankhead senior was Representative 1887-1907; Senator, 1907-1920

In this striking photograph by Harris & Ewing, taken in 1917, we see John Hollis Bankhead, a prominent Representative from Alabama, proudly posing with his son, William Brockman Bankhead. John Hollis Bankhead served in the House of Representatives from 1887 to 1907 and later in the Senate from 1907 to 1920. The father-son duo is dressed in formal attire, reflecting the era's fashion trends. John Hollis Bankhead wears a three-piece suit, complete with a vest and a bow tie, while William B. Bankhead dons a shirt, tie, and a jacket. The elder Bankhead sports a fedora hat, adding an air of sophistication to his appearance. The photograph captures the strong bond between the two men, with John Hollis Bankhead placing a protective hand on his son's shoulder. The setting is unclear, but the background shows a glass-enclosed location, possibly a library or a congressional office.
